Why Cardio Isn’t Enough: Discover the Power of Strength Training for Women Over 40
Cardio has long been the go-to for many looking to stay in shape, boost energy, or shed a few pounds. And while it’s a fantastic tool for heart health and mental well-being, the truth is — cardio alone isn’t enough. Especially for women over 40, a well-rounded fitness routine should include strength training, mobility, and recovery work to truly feel and function at your best.
If you’re looking for sustainable results, better energy, and a fitness routine that supports you through every season of life, strength training for women over 40 is the game-changer.
1. Cardio Can’t Do It All
Yes, cardio burns calories. But it doesn’t build muscle, improve posture, or support long-term bone health. In fact, relying only on cardio may lead to muscle loss and a slower metabolism — two things that naturally start to shift with age.
If your goal is to feel stronger, leaner, and more capable in your day-to-day life, your body needs more than just the treadmill.
2. Strength Training: The Missing Piece
Strength training is one of the most effective (and underrated) tools for women 40 and beyond. It helps you:
- Build lean muscle
- Boost metabolism
- Improve insulin sensitivity
- Increase bone density
- Support hormone health
And no, lifting weights won’t make you bulky — it’ll make you powerful.
As explained in this CNET article, women don’t have enough testosterone to get bulky, and building significant muscle mass requires specific conditions that are not typically met through standard strength training routines.
